在前端开发中,日期选取器是一个常见的组件,用于让用户选择日期。而将日期选取器中的日期搜索传递给控制器,可以通过以下步骤实现:
- 在前端页面中,使用HTML和JavaScript创建一个日期选取器组件。可以使用HTML5的<input type="date">元素或者第三方的日期选择插件,如jQuery UI Datepicker等。确保日期选取器能够在用户界面上显示,并且用户可以选择日期。
- 使用JavaScript监听日期选取器的值变化事件。当用户选择日期时,触发相应的事件处理函数。
- 在事件处理函数中,获取日期选取器的值。可以使用JavaScript的DOM操作或者jQuery等库来获取选取器的值。
- 将获取到的日期值通过AJAX或者其他方式发送给后端控制器。AJAX可以使用原生的XMLHttpRequest对象或者更方便的jQuery的$.ajax()方法来发送异步请求。
- 后端控制器接收到日期值后,可以进行相应的处理。根据具体的业务需求,可以将日期值存储到数据库中、进行数据查询、生成报表等操作。
在腾讯云的产品中,可以使用云函数(Serverless Cloud Function)来实现后端控制器的功能。云函数是一种无服务器的计算服务,可以让开发者在云端运行代码,无需关心服务器的配置和管理。腾讯云云函数支持多种编程语言,如Node.js、Python、Java等,开发者可以根据自己的喜好和项目需求选择合适的语言进行开发。
推荐的腾讯云产品:
- 云函数(Serverless Cloud Function):https://cloud.tencent.com/product/scf
- 云数据库MySQL版:https://cloud.tencent.com/product/cdb_mysql
- 云数据库MongoDB版:https://cloud.tencent.com/product/cdb_mongodb
- 云数据库Redis版:https://cloud.tencent.com/product/cdb_redis
- 云数据库SQL Server版:https://cloud.tencent.com/product/cdb_sqlserver
以上是一个基本的实现思路,具体的实现方式和技术选型可以根据项目需求和开发者的实际情况进行调整。